What are the sequelae and risks of IVF?



Sequelae and risk of IVF

1. Pregnancy complications

IVF technology is a complex medical process, which involves multiple operations and drug use, so it may increase the risk of complications for mothers during pregnancy. Some common complications include pregnancy induced hypertension, gestational diabetes mellitus and placental abruption. These complications may threaten the health of both mother and baby to varying degrees.

For example, pregnancy induced hypertension is one of the common risks faced by IVF women. In this case, the increased blood pressure of pregnant women may cause proteinuria, edema and other symptoms, and may even develop into pre eclampsia or eclampsia in serious cases, threatening the life safety of mothers and infants.

In addition, hormone drugs used in IVF may also increase the risk of gestational diabetes mellitus for mothers. Gestational diabetes will increase the chance of pregnant women suffering from pregnancy induced hypertension and fetal macrosomia, and may lead to placental insufficiency.

2. Problems caused by multiple pregnancy

IVF technology usually fertilizes and cultivates multiple fertilized eggs in the laboratory, and then implants multiple fertilized eggs into the mother, so the probability of multiple pregnancy is high. Multiple pregnancy may cause a series of health problems.

First, multiple pregnancies increase the risk of premature delivery. Premature infants often need additional care and medical support due to incomplete development of lungs and other organs at birth.

4. Psychological and social factors

IVF technology often requires patients to go through a long treatment process, which may bring some negative effects in emotional and psychological aspects. For example, long-term infertility treatment and IVF process may exert certain pressure on the couple's psychology and family relationship.

In addition, the society's views on IVF may also cause some pressure on patients. Discrimination or prejudice against IVF children may have adverse effects on their social and physical and mental health.

summary

Although IVF technology helps many infertile couples achieve their reproductive aspirations, it also has certain risks and sequelae. These risks include pregnancy complications, problems caused by multiple pregnancies, the possibility of genetic defects, and psychological and social factors. Before accepting IVF technology, patients should fully understand these risks and have detailed discussions and decisions with doctors.
